35986841_10216840653711318_1105697261150535680_n

customers attitude the new shopping malls in egypt / GP / DR : El sayed nagy

Dina batrawi

customers attitude the new shopping malls in egypt / GP / DR : El sayed nagy - MSA, [2003] - ill

658